Enable job alerts via email!

Senior Software Quality Engineer

Expleo

Cape Town

Hybrid

ZAR 600,000 - 900,000

Full time

Yesterday
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Start fresh or import an existing resume

Job summary

A leading company in integrated engineering and quality services is seeking a Senior Software Quality Engineer in Cape Town. You will be instrumental in designing and implementing automated tests, contributing to agile delivery, and enhancing CI/CD pipelines. This hybrid role emphasizes collaboration and high-quality software delivery, providing a robust career development journey within a dynamic environment.

Qualifications

  • Proven expertise in test automation across UI, API, and integration testing.
  • Experience in designing test automation frameworks.
  • Strong understanding of agile methodologies with active sprint engagement.

Responsibilities

  • Develop and maintain automated tests across UI, API, and integration layers.
  • Integrate automated tests into CI/CD pipelines to ensure efficient deployments.
  • Continuously improve test coverage and contribute to quality strategies.

Skills

Test Automation
Problem Solving
Collaboration
Attention to Detail
Agile Methodologies

Education

Bachelor’s Degree in Computer Science, Information Systems, or related field
ISEB / ISTQB Certification
Additional course or certification in Quality Engineering

Tools

Playwright
JavaScript
TypeScript
CI/CD Pipelines

Job description

Overview

Expleo is a trusted partner for end-to-end, integrated engineering, quality services and management consulting for digital transformation. We are a talent incubator. The time you spend at Expleo will turbo-charge your career, allowing you to work on complex technical challenges, enjoy opportunities to expand your skills and take part in inspiring, multi-disciplinary collaborations with your colleagues. Whether working on autonomous vehicles, green planes, the factories of tomorrow or cutting-edge banking technology, you will have the opportunity to become a bolder version of yourself. Let’s change the game together.

We are looking for a skilled and driven Senior Software Quality Engineer to join our team in Cape Town (Hybrid – minimum 3 days onsite at Pinelands office).

In this role, you’ll play a key part in designing and implementing robust automated testing solutions, actively contributing to agile delivery, and integrating quality practices into the CI/CD pipeline. You’ll bring strong technical expertise and a collaborative mindset to help deliver high-quality, reliable software.

Responsibilities
  • Develop and maintain automated tests across UI, API, and integration layers.
  • Design, enhance, and maintain test automation frameworks for scalable and maintainable testing.
  • Participate actively in agile ceremonies, contributing to sprint planning, refinement, and quality-related discussions.
  • Integrate automated tests into CI/CD pipelines to ensure rapid feedback and efficient deployments.
  • Analyse test results, identify defects, and collaborate with developers to drive timely resolutions.
  • Continuously improve test coverage, efficiency, and effectiveness.
  • Contribute to quality strategies and promote best practices in test automation and quality engineering.
  • (Advantageous) Contribute to performance and security testing initiatives as needed.
Qualifications
  • Bachelor’s Degree in Computer Science, Information Systems, or other related field, or equivalent work experience
  • ISEB / ISTQB Certification
  • Additional course or certification in Quality Engineering
Experience
  • Strong hands-on experience in test automation, covering:
    • UI testing
    • API testing
    • Integration testing
  • Proven expertise in designing and implementing test automation frameworks.
  • Proficiency in Playwright using JavaScript/TypeScript.
  • Experience integrating automated tests into CI/CD pipelines.
  • Strong understanding of agile methodologies and active participation in sprint activities.
  • Excellent problem-solving skills and attention to detail.
  • Solid communication and collaboration skills.
  • Advantageous: Experience in performance testing and security testing.
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.